  23. This is a playthrough I have planned where nichelings who were never born get a chance to live. Their mother maybe died, or they were deleted by console commands, or another reason. Whatever the case, they've now been given a chance at life on an island created specifically for them. And you can throw your never-born nichelings into the mix! They will start as one day old babies, and have to survive 2-3 days completely helpless. After that, 7-10 days of the one-gemmed stage. Then teens for about 20 days. It will be a long road to adulthood for the young nichelings, but there is a chance wanderers could adopt them. If you want to submit a nicheling for consideration, they must be one that was conceived in one of your playthroughs but never born for whatever reason. If they were never actually conceived but have an impressive backstory I may consider them. Regarding parents' genes, a screenshot would be best, if you don't have one try and be specific as possible. If blind genes send a pic of them along with speculation. Parents' personality is mainly important in-so-far as genetics plays a role in a creature's personality. If personality unknown put unknown. Standing is rank, you can put their tribe rank, or simply member, wanderer, rogue, ect. This line is for both parents. Relatives can be notable for uniqye personality, famed deeds (good or bad), rank, unusual skills, ect. This is not for the parents and you can put NA. You must provide at least a base reason (mpther died, deleted using commands, ect) and that will give me creative liscense to fill in the rest. You can tell more detail or make a story surrounding it, though. Other is for background info that doesn't fit into the catagories above. The personality of your character will be determined by their genes and experiances, so don't say what sort of a nicheling they are Here's the form: Father's genes: Mother's genes: Father's personality: Mother's personality: Parents' standing in tribe: Notable relatives: Reason for never being born: Island on which they were conceived/died in womb: Other:
